About to be cake

Not much has been happening apart from work but I have had leave approved at Christmas which means I can go home to Aus for a few days which means I can also make the Christmas cakes. My self imposed deadline for this activity is Melbourne Cup Day - the first Tuesday in November. This gives the cakes plenty of time to mature and have at least two dowses of brandy. As we have a long weekend here for labour day the timing is perfect, the fruit has been soaking and the happy hen eggs are all lined up and ready to go.

Trophy count - 3

Sometimes the wierdest things happen. I was in Auckland for work last Thursday. On the flight home I was in 9B, in 10B was the 2011 Melbourne Cup on it's way to the Hawera Races. I lived in Melbourne for 6 years and never got to the races, let alone anywhere near the actual cup.
So...William Webb Ellis (Rugby World Cup) Trophy - Tick. Ranfurly Shield - Tick. Melbourne Cup - Tick.
